Le succès d'un site web repose en grande partie sur sa visibilité dans les moteurs de recherche. En effet, près de 53% du trafic d'un site web provient de la recherche organique, soulignant l'importance cruciale du référencement (SEO) et des **outils SEO**. Le rôle du développeur web, traditionnellement axé sur le code et la fonctionnalité, s'étend désormais à la conception et à la maintenance de sites web optimisés pour le SEO et performants avec différents **outils de référencement**. Cette évolution exige de nouvelles compétences et une compréhension approfondie des **outils SEO pour développeurs web**. Dans un marché du travail de plus en plus compétitif, les développeurs web dotés de ces compétences se démarquent et sont très recherchés par les employeurs.
Nous aborderons les compétences SEO essentielles, les outils spécifiques à maîtriser (comme **Google Analytics, Search Console, Screaming Frog**), et comment rester à la pointe des techniques SEO. Le but est de fournir aux développeurs web les informations nécessaires pour augmenter leur employabilité et progresser dans leur carrière en maîtrisant les **meilleurs outils SEO**.
Comprendre les compétences SEO essentielles pour un développeur web
Avant de plonger dans les outils, il est crucial de comprendre les bases du SEO et comment les **outils SEO** peuvent aider. En effet, un développeur web doit non seulement maîtriser les aspects techniques, mais également comprendre comment ces aspects contribuent à améliorer le positionnement d'un site web dans les résultats de recherche grâce à des **outils d'analyse SEO**. Cette compréhension permet de prendre des décisions éclairées lors de la conception et du développement, en intégrant les meilleures pratiques SEO dès le départ. Cela assure que le site est non seulement fonctionnel et esthétiquement plaisant, mais aussi facilement indexable et compréhensible par les moteurs de recherche. Sans cette base solide, l'utilisation des **outils de référencement avancés** serait inefficace et incomplète.
Les fondamentaux du SEO
Voici les fondamentaux du SEO que tout développeur web doit connaître, et comment les **outils d'audit SEO** peuvent aider :
- Structure et balisage : La structure du site et l'utilisation correcte des balises HTML sont essentielles pour le SEO, et peuvent être analysées avec des **outils SEO techniques**.
- Optimisation du contenu : La qualité et la pertinence du contenu sont cruciales pour attirer et retenir les visiteurs, et peuvent être améliorées avec des **outils d'aide à la rédaction SEO**.
- Performance du site : La vitesse de chargement et l'adaptabilité mobile sont des facteurs importants pour l'expérience utilisateur et le SEO, mesurables avec des **outils de performance SEO**.
La structure du site web et le balisage HTML jouent un rôle important dans le SEO. Les balises <title>, <meta description>, <h1> à <h6> aident les moteurs de recherche à comprendre le contenu de chaque page. L'utilisation d'une sémantique HTML appropriée (ex: <article>, <nav>, <aside>) améliore également la compréhension du contenu par les moteurs de recherche. Une structure de site claire et une URL bien pensée facilitent la navigation pour les utilisateurs et les robots d'exploration. On peut auditer ceci avec un **outil comme Screaming Frog**.
SEO technique
Le SEO technique concerne les aspects techniques du site qui influencent son référencement et qui peuvent être optimisés grâce à des **outils d'optimisation SEO** :
- Indexation : Assurer que le site est correctement indexé par les moteurs de recherche, en utilisant des **outils comme Google Search Console**.
- Données structurées (Schema.org) : Utiliser les données structurées pour fournir des informations supplémentaires aux moteurs de recherche et améliorer les rich snippets, en validant avec des **outils de test Schema**.
- Balisage Canonique : Gérer le contenu dupliqué avec le balisage canonique, en détectant les problèmes avec des **outils d'audit de contenu dupliqué**.
Le fichier robots.txt indique aux robots des moteurs de recherche quelles parties du site ne doivent pas être explorées. Le sitemap.xml, quant à lui, facilite l'exploration du site en fournissant une liste de toutes les pages. La gestion des erreurs d'exploration, telles que les erreurs 404 (page non trouvée) et les redirections 301 (redirection permanente), est cruciale pour maintenir un site web sain et optimisé pour le SEO. L'utilisation de données structurées (Schema.org) permet de fournir aux moteurs de recherche des informations contextuelles sur le contenu du site, ce qui peut améliorer la visibilité dans les résultats de recherche. Un développeur web compétent utilisera des **outils d'analyse de logs** pour identifier et corriger ces problèmes.
Lien entre les compétences SEO et les tâches quotidiennes du développeur web
Les compétences SEO ont un impact direct sur les tâches quotidiennes d'un développeur web. L'implémentation d'un CDN (Content Delivery Network) pour améliorer la vitesse de chargement du site est un exemple concret. L'optimisation des images lors de l'intégration, en utilisant des balises alt descriptives et en compressant les images pour réduire leur taille, est un autre exemple. La création de sites web "mobile-first" et la mise en place d'un protocole HTTPS sont également des tâches essentielles qui contribuent à améliorer le SEO. L'utilisation d'**outils de test mobile** est cruciale. 94% des recherches mobile impactent le SEO local.
En tant que développeur web, comprendre l'importance de chaque action permet de créer des sites performants. Cela facilite aussi le travail des équipes SEO, permettant un positionnement du site optimal. En moyenne, une optimisation mobile permet d'améliorer le positionnement de 30%.
Voici des éléments clés à intégrer lors du développement :
- Gestion des balises canoniques
- Audit de l'arborescence du site
- Mise en place d'un maillage interne optimisé
Zoom sur les outils de référencement : lesquels maîtriser et pourquoi ?
Il existe une multitude d'**outils d'optimisation SEO** disponibles sur le marché. Comprendre leur utilité et savoir lesquels maîtriser est essentiel pour tout développeur web souhaitant contribuer activement à l'optimisation SEO d'un site. Ces outils permettent d'analyser, de suivre, d'optimiser et de surveiller les performances d'un site web dans les moteurs de recherche. Ils fournissent des informations précieuses sur les mots-clés, la concurrence, les erreurs techniques et l'expérience utilisateur. Choisir les bons outils et savoir les utiliser efficacement permet de gagner du temps et d'obtenir des résultats significatifs. L'utilisation d'**outils d'analyse de la concurrence** est aussi très importante.
Outils d'analyse et de suivi
Les outils d'analyse et de suivi permettent de mesurer les performances du site et d'identifier les points à améliorer :
- Google Analytics : Analyse du trafic, du comportement des utilisateurs, des conversions, outil essentiel pour comprendre l'impact des efforts SEO.
- Google Search Console : Suivi de l'indexation, des erreurs d'exploration, des performances de recherche, outil indispensable pour identifier les problèmes techniques.
- Outils d'analyse de la vitesse (ex: PageSpeed Insights, GTmetrix) : Diagnostic des problèmes de performance et suggestions d'amélioration, essentiel pour l'expérience utilisateur et le SEO.
Google Analytics est un outil puissant qui permet d'analyser le trafic d'un site web, le comportement des utilisateurs et les conversions. Il permet de configurer des objectifs et de suivre les événements pour mesurer l'efficacité des campagnes marketing. En 2023, 67% des entreprises utilisent Google Analytics pour suivre leurs performances SEO. Google Search Console, quant à lui, permet de suivre l'indexation du site, d'identifier les erreurs d'exploration et d'analyser les performances de recherche. Il offre également la possibilité de soumettre des sitemaps et de demander l'indexation de nouvelles pages. Le PageSpeed Insights et GTmetrix permettent d'analyser la vitesse de chargement d'un site et de fournir des suggestions d'amélioration, telles que la compression des images, la minification du code et l'utilisation d'un CDN. 47% des consommateurs s'attendent à ce qu'une page charge en moins de 2 secondes.
Outils d'optimisation technique
Ces outils aident à identifier et corriger les problèmes techniques qui peuvent nuire au SEO :
- Screaming Frog SEO Spider : Exploration et audit du site, identification des erreurs et des opportunités d'optimisation, outil puissant pour identifier les problèmes techniques à grande échelle.
- Lighthouse (intégré à Chrome DevTools) : Analyse de la performance, de l'accessibilité, du SEO et des bonnes pratiques pour le web, outil gratuit et accessible pour un audit rapide.
Screaming Frog SEO Spider analyse un site en profondeur et permet de dénicher les erreurs. Que ce soit des liens brisés, des titres manquants ou des erreurs d'indexation, cet outil est très utile. Pour les sites en Javascript, il est parfait car il permet de voir le rendu final. Lighthouse, intégré à Chrome, est aussi un outil gratuit et très puissant. 62% des sites web ont des liens brisés selon Ahrefs.
Outils d'aide à la gestion de contenu et à la rédaction SEO
Ces outils facilitent l'optimisation du contenu pour les moteurs de recherche :
- Yoast SEO (WordPress) ou autres plugins similaires : Optimisation des balises title et meta description, analyse de la lisibilité du contenu, outil facile à utiliser pour les débutants.
Yoast SEO permet d'optimiser très simplement son contenu. Il permet de facilement modifier la balise title et la méta-description afin d'obtenir un positionnement optimal dans les moteurs de recherches. Facile d'accès, le plugin est un atout majeur pour l'optimisation du contenu. 35% des sites WordPress utilisent Yoast SEO selon BuiltWith.
Pour un développeur web, voici une liste d'outils à absolument maitriser pour améliorer l'architecture SEO du site:
- Google Page Speed
- SemRush
- Google Search Console
- Screaming Frog
Comment les compétences en outils de référencement valorisent le profil du développeur web
Les compétences en **outils d'analyse SEO** ne sont plus un simple atout, mais une nécessité pour les développeurs web souhaitant se démarquer sur le marché du travail. En effet, un développeur web capable de créer des sites web optimisés pour le SEO dès la conception est un atout précieux pour toute entreprise. Ces compétences se traduisent par une augmentation de l'employabilité, une meilleure collaboration avec les équipes marketing et SEO, et une valeur ajoutée significative pour l'entreprise. La maîtrise d'**outils de suivi de positionnement** est aussi un élément clé.
Augmentation de l'employabilité
Le marché du travail est en constante évolution, et les compétences SEO sont de plus en plus demandées chez les développeurs web. Selon une étude récente, 72% des entreprises considèrent les compétences SEO comme un critère important lors du recrutement d'un développeur web. 85% des recruteurs pensent que les compétences SEO sont un avantage significatif. Des offres d'emploi spécifiques recherchant des compétences SEO sont de plus en plus courantes. Cela représente une opportunité pour les développeurs web qui ont investi dans le développement de leurs compétences SEO. L'utilisation d'**outils de reporting SEO** est un atout majeur.
D'après un rapport, les développeurs ayant des compétences en SEO sont embauchés 18% plus rapidement que les autres. En moyenne, un développeur web avec des compétences SEO gagne 15% de plus.
Capacité à créer des sites web performants et optimisés pour le SEO dès la conception
Un développeur web compétent en SEO est capable de créer des sites web performants et optimisés pour le SEO dès la conception. Cela se traduit par une réduction des coûts et du temps passé à optimiser le site après sa mise en ligne. Un site web optimisé pour le SEO offre une meilleure expérience utilisateur grâce à une navigation intuitive et des pages qui chargent rapidement. Cette approche proactive permet d'éviter les problèmes techniques et d'assurer une visibilité optimale dans les moteurs de recherche. En moyenne, un site optimisé dès le départ coûte 30% moins cher à maintenir.
Communication et collaboration plus efficaces avec les équipes marketing et SEO
Un développeur web doté de compétences SEO peut facilement comprendre les besoins et les enjeux des équipes marketing et SEO. Cette compréhension facilite la communication et la collaboration, permettant de proposer des solutions techniques adaptées aux objectifs SEO. Un développeur web qui comprend le SEO peut anticiper les problèmes potentiels et proposer des solutions proactives. Cela permet d'améliorer l'efficacité des campagnes marketing et d'augmenter le trafic organique du site web. 63% des équipes marketing estiment que la collaboration avec les développeurs est cruciale pour le succès du SEO.
Voici 5 exemples de points à échanger entre développeur et équipes SEO:
- L'optimisation de la vitesse du site
- La mise en place de balises canoniques
- La gestion du contenu dupliqué
- La mise en place d'un maillage interne
- L'optimisation des images
Apprentissage et veille : rester à la pointe des outils et des techniques SEO
Le SEO est un domaine en constante évolution. Il est donc crucial pour les développeurs web de rester à la pointe des **outils de suivi SEO** et des techniques SEO. Cet apprentissage continu passe par l'exploration de ressources en ligne, la participation à des communautés et des forums, et la veille technologique. Il est également important de mettre en pratique les connaissances acquises en travaillant sur des projets personnels ou bénévoles et en obtenant des certifications SEO pour valider ses compétences. Rester informé sur les **outils d'intelligence artificielle pour le SEO** est de plus en plus important.
Ressources en ligne
De nombreuses ressources en ligne permettent d'apprendre et de se tenir informé des dernières tendances SEO et sur les **outils de monitoring SEO** :
- Blogs et sites web spécialisés en SEO (ex : Search Engine Journal, Moz Blog, Ahrefs Blog), une source d'informations précieuses et mises à jour régulièrement.
- Cours en ligne (ex : Coursera, Udemy, OpenClassrooms), pour une formation structurée et approfondie.
Le site de Search Engine Journal est mis à jour régulièrement et est une très bonne source d'information. Ahrefs propose aussi des formations de qualité. Suivre ces blogs est un très bon moyen de rester à la page. En moyenne, un développeur web passe 5 heures par semaine à se former au SEO.
Communautés et forums
Les communautés et les forums sont d'excellents endroits pour poser des questions et échanger des informations avec d'autres professionnels du SEO. Suivre des experts SEO sur les réseaux sociaux permet également de se tenir informé des dernières tendances et des meilleures pratiques. 42% des développeurs web utilisent les forums pour se tenir informés.
Veille technologique
L'abonnement à des newsletters et à des flux RSS est un excellent moyen de suivre les dernières tendances et les mises à jour des **outils d'audit technique SEO**. La participation à des conférences et à des événements sur le SEO permet de rencontrer d'autres professionnels et de découvrir les dernières innovations. Il existe plus de 200 conférences sur le SEO chaque année.
Selon les experts, il faut faire de la veille au moins une fois par semaine pour être à jour. Ceci peut être facilité en suivant des experts sur les réseaux sociaux. 78% des experts SEO utilisent Twitter pour leur veille technologique.
Mise en pratique
Travailler sur des projets personnels ou bénévoles est un excellent moyen d'appliquer les connaissances acquises et de développer ses compétences SEO. L'obtention de certifications SEO, telles que la certification Google Analytics, permet de valider ses compétences et de les mettre en valeur auprès des employeurs. 65% des développeurs web mettent en pratique leurs compétences SEO sur des projets personnels.
Voici 3 certifications à avoir en priorité:
- Certifications Google Analytics
- Certifications SemRush
- Certifications Ahrefs
Conclusion : investir dans le SEO, un investissement rentable pour sa carrière
Le SEO est plus qu'un simple atout pour les développeurs web; c'est un impératif stratégique qui peut façonner leur carrière et contribuer à la croissance des entreprises. Les compétences SEO essentielles permettent aux développeurs web de créer des sites qui non seulement fonctionnent parfaitement, mais aussi excellent en termes de visibilité et d'engagement. En maîtrisant les **outils d'analyse SEO**, d'optimisation technique et de gestion de contenu, les développeurs peuvent transformer les défis techniques en opportunités de succès. Il est donc crucial pour les développeurs d'investir dans leur formation SEO, de suivre les tendances émergentes et de mettre en pratique leurs compétences pour créer des solutions innovantes et efficaces. En adoptant cette approche proactive, les développeurs peuvent non seulement assurer leur succès professionnel, mais aussi jouer un rôle clé dans l'amélioration de l'expérience en ligne pour les utilisateurs et le succès des entreprises. Un développeur SEO gagne en moyenne 65000 euros par an.